GQ0A021821GBT Description
GQ0A021821GBT Description
The GQ0A021821GBT from TT Electronics/IRC is a high-performance thin-film resistor network designed for precision applications requiring stable resistance values and tight tolerances. This 20-pin QSOP (Quarter-Small Outline Package) device features 10 isolated resistors, each with a 1.82KΩ resistance value and a 2% tolerance, ensuring consistent performance in demanding circuits. The ceramic case style and gull-wing termination enable reliable surface-mount (SMD) integration, while the ±50ppm/°C temperature coefficient guarantees minimal resistance drift across a wide operating range of -70°C to +125°C. With a 1W total power rating (0.1W per resistor) and 100V maximum voltage rating, this network is ideal for analog signal conditioning, voltage division, and isolation circuits.
GQ0A021821GBT Features
- Precision Thin Film Technology: Delivers low noise and high stability for sensitive applications.
- Isolated Resistor Design (ISOL): Each of the 10 resistors operates independently, reducing crosstalk.
- Robust Ceramic Package: Enhances thermal performance and mechanical durability.
- Wide Temperature Range: Operates reliably from -70°C to +125°C with derated power.
- Compact QSOP Form Factor: 8.66mm × 6.02mm × 1.47mm dimensions with tight tolerances (±0.1mm length/height, ±0.2mm depth).
- Gull-Wing Termination: Facilitates automated PCB assembly and strong solder joints.
- Non-Automotive, Non-PPAP: Suitable for industrial and commercial applications.
